When people hear the word “hacking”, they tend to get cautious because it is a term that is normally associated with malicious activity. However, ethical hacking is very different from that because it is used for the benefit of the industry. Ethical hacking is used to find loopholes in target systems so that those weaknesses and vulnerabilities may be addressed later on. An Ethical Hacker does not do any kind of malicious activity to hurt the system, instead, they strive to make it better.
If you wish to become a Certified Ethical Hacker, you first need to know a few things about the International Council of Electronic Commerce Consultants (EC-Council). It is an organization that certifies people in different skills. Ec-Council CEH Certification Practice Test is known as the creator and owner of Certified Ethical Hacker (CEH) credential. It also offers other credentials like Certified Network Defender (CND), Computer Hacking Forensics Investigator (CHFI) Certified Chief Information Security Officer (CCISO) and many more.
Certified Ethical Hacking certification is intended for site administrators, security professionals, auditors, security officers and basically anyone who is concerned about the safety and security of the network infrastructure. CEH certification was introduced in 2003 and since then it has provided the best ethical hacking standard worldwide. CEH even became the baseline certification for the United States Department of Defense. It is also ANSI-compliant which increases its value and credibility. To become CEH certified, you need to pass two exams, namely CEH (ANSI) and CEH (Practical).
CEH Exam
Passing CEH (ANSI) exam can change your life, but in order to do that, you first need to know the exam. The code for CEH (ANSI) exam is 312-50 and it comprises of 125 questions. All of the questions are based on the multiple-choice format. Each candidate has exactly 4 hours to answer all of the questions. The passing score for the exam ranges from 60% to 85% depending on the questions included in the exam. The cost for this test is $950 USD.
Upon completion of 312-50 exam, you are required to take CEH (Practical) test. This exam requires the candidates to complete 20 practical tasks in 6 hours. The passing score for this exam is 70%. There are a few different topics that make up the practical exam. You need to prepare for all of these topics properly to do your best and pass the test. These are some important skills that CEH (Practical) exam measures:
- Ability to understand attack vectors and perform network scanning to classify vulnerable parts of the network
- Ability to execute user enumeration, OS banner grabbing and service
- Ability to execute steganography, steganalysis attacks, system hacking and packet sniffing
- Ability to use and identify malware, computer worms and viruses
- Ability to conduct web application and web server attacks and execute SQL injection /cryptography attacks
- Ability to identify security loopholes in the network
